CVE-2020-25168

Hard-coded credentials in the B. Braun Melsungen AG SpaceCom Version L81/U61 and earlier, and the Data module compactplus Versions A10 and A11 enable attackers with command line access to access the device’s Wi-Fi module.
A workaround or mitigation is available. Apply it until an official patch is released.
